Handover note — leased laptop returns

Priya,

All fourteen leased laptops for the Hollis contract are wiped, asset tags photographed, and packed two per padded carton. Chargers are bagged separately in carton 7. The lessor's courier, Vantry Haulage, collects Wednesday afternoon. Count cartons on arrival and keep the manifest copy. For the hand-over, observe the confidential instruction below.

drop instructions, yafog-yawip: the quenmir olidor courier leaves the julox tamion keliel ledger at gate 5283 under passcode 336825

- [ ] Step 7: Archive cold storage buckets (Glacierline tier). Confirm both ceremony witnesses are present, verify bucket manifests match the Oxbow ledger, then seal the archive key shares. Plugin authors may observe but not handle shares. Once sealed, the archive index itself is encrypted and can only be reopened with the passphrase below.

vault phrase of badup-hahig = tamael-aldael-kelmir-istael-fenok-istwyn-tamius-jorath-oliion

### Runbook: ReceiptRelay mailer stuck

Symptoms: donation receipts queueing, no sends, queue depth alert fires.

First: check the SMTP relay health endpoint. If healthy, the mailer worker is probably wedged on a malformed template — restart the worker pool, not the whole service. If unhealthy, fail over to the secondary relay and page the infra rotation. Do not replay the dead-letter queue until dedupe is confirmed on, or donors get duplicate receipts. Verify the service is running with the following configuration values.

config for kajeg-bafop:
[julael]
host = julael.plorvadata.corp
user = julael_svc
database = julael_prod

**Ticket FT-LOCKERS — Changing Room Locker Assignment (Night Shift)**

Night-shift staff at the Dunmore Yard depot have been assigned lockers 41–58 in the north changing room. Please check each locker is empty and tag it with the occupant's surname before Thursday. Report any jammed doors on this ticket. The changing room keypad has been reset; the new entry code is below.

turnstile pass: bdg-FVNQRS-72965873

- [ ] Digest scheduler key step (for the new contractor): During the Brindlewick key ceremony, you'll re-seed the batch email digest scheduler so nightly sends resume after rotation. Nothing fancy — the Hollowgate console walks you through it, but it will stop and ask for the recovery passphrase, which is the one right below.

unlock words, yawig-kagef: gordor-holvan-ulaael-pramir-ulaiel-tamdor